Restylane
There are various injected cosmetic fillers
that work to improve overall facial appearance
and attain a more youthful look. Some of
these include fat and collagen injections.
Restylane is a newer form of cosmetic filler
that has advantages that overcome fat or
collagen injections.
Restylane is a clear gel that is based
on a natural substance called hyaluronic
acid. This acid is found naturally within
the human body, therefore, is not harmful
when injected. The acid works mostly with
cartilage to protect joints but it helps
to protect the rest of the body as well.
Aging causes hyaluronic acid within the
body to thin, so when Restylane is injected,
it can add volume and help shape softer,
smoother and healthier skin.
Restylane is injected in tiny amounts into
the skin with a very fine needle, and joins
together with the body’s own hyaluronic
acid to cause an increase in volume. It
maintains its shape using the body’s
own moisture. The hyaluronic acid, once
injected, attaches itself to water molecules
within the body. As the acid breaks down,
every molecule binds to water, so, over
time, the same amount of volume can be retained
while using less hyaluronic acid. Through
these injections, Restylane is used to smooth
wrinkles, shape lips and form facial contours.
When used, it results in a more youthful
appearance.
The procedure involving Restylane injections
can take anywhere from a few minutes to
about an hour. It all depends on the size
of the area being treated. The use of the
fine needle minimizes pain but patients
can request an anesthetic if needed. The
injection results can be seen almost immediately.
Treatment areas may be swollen or red for
a day or so but usually no longer than that.
Many factors including age, skin type and
daily activities may influence the results
of the injections, but Restylane injections
have been known to last six months or even
longer. Overall, Restylane is a safe and
effective way to inject cosmetic fillers
that will immediately begin to restore your
youthful skin.
